# Contact page

The default contact page consists of 3 main sections:

* banner
* contact form
* map

### From contact

This section is for the contact form. It will print the form where your clients can get in touch with you. The fields of the form are:

* name
* email
* subject
* message

Using the section blocks you can add details about: contacts (email, phone), address, working hours.

### Map

With the map section you can print a map and show where your store/office is located at. To do so fill the fields in the form.

**Note:** you'll need a Google Maps API key. More details here: <https://support.google.com/googleapi/answer/6158862?hl=en>
